KD Logo

Stoke Therapeutics Inc [STOK] Investment Appeal on the Rise

Stoke Therapeutics Inc’s recently made public that its 10% Owner Skorpios Trust unloaded Company’s shares for reported $23.0 million on Dec 23 ’24. In the deal valued at $11.50 per share,2,000,000 shares were sold. As a result of this transaction, Skorpios Trust now holds 6,906,181 shares worth roughly $79.35 million.

Then, Blue Horizon Enterprise Ltd bought 2,000,000 shares, generating $23,180,000 in total proceeds.

Before that, Ticho Barry sold 2,586 shares. Stoke Therapeutics Inc shares valued at $33,596 were divested by the CHIEF MEDICAL OFFICER at a price of $12.99 per share. As a result of the transaction, Ticho Barry now holds 44,746 shares, worth roughly $0.51 million.

Chardan Capital Markets initiated its Stoke Therapeutics Inc [STOK] rating to a Buy in a research note published on December 20, 2024; the price target was $24. TD Cowen also remained covering STOK and has increased its forecast on March 26, 2024 with a “an Outperform” recommendation from previously “Market perform” rating.

Price Performance Review of STOK

On Friday, Stoke Therapeutics Inc [NASDAQ:STOK] saw its stock jump 1.95% to $11.49. Over the last five days, the stock has gained 2.22%. Stoke Therapeutics Inc shares have risen nearly 4.17% since the year began. Nevertheless, the stocks have risen 109.67% over the past one year. While a 52-week high of $17.58 was reached on 01/03/25, a 52-week low of $4.09 was recorded on 01/02/25. SMA at 50 days reached $12.24, while 200 days put it at $13.14.

Levels Of Support And Resistance For STOK Stock

The 24-hour chart illustrates a support level at 11.20, which if violated will result in even more drops to 10.92. On the upside, there is a resistance level at 11.75. A further resistance level may holdings at 12.02. The Relative Strength Index (RSI) on the 14-day chart is 46.13, which indicates neutral technical sentiment, while the Moving Average Convergence Divergence (MACD) stands at -0.19, which suggests price will go down in the next trading period. Percent R suggests that price movement has been low at 53.17%. Stochastics %K at 30.58% indicates the stock is a holding.

How much short interest is there in Stoke Therapeutics Inc?

A steep rise in short interest was recorded in Stoke Therapeutics Inc stocks on 2024-12-13, growing by 0.85 million shares to a total of 7.26 million shares. Yahoo Finance data shows the prior-month short interest on 2024-11-15 was 6.4 million shares. There was a rise of 11.75%, which implies that there is a positive sentiment for the stock.

Most Popular